Albert Speer was a German architect who was Minister of Armaments and War Production in Nazi Germany during World War II. Therefore, he was part of the leadership of the Nazi government, with which he had direct responsibility for the decisions of this regime, thus being largely responsible for the war crimes that Germany committed during World War II. In addition, since he was in charge of producing the armaments necessary to sustain the war, and designing new weapons developments capable of wreaking havoc on enemies, Speer had a fundamental role in the battle conditions of the war. For these reasons, Speer was sentenced to 20 years in prison during the Nuremberg Trials, which was appropriate given his participation in the Nazi regime.
